On-chain analytics firm Glassnode has recently turned the spotlight on a pivotal Bitcoin price level that traders and investors should keep a close eye on. According to its latest analysis, a significant cluster of Bitcoin was purchased at around $106,600 back on December 16.

The “Cost Basis Distribution” (CBD) indicator showcases the price point where a significant amount of Bitcoin’s supply was introduced to the market. As Bitcoin hovers around $105,200, this level is gaining interest as a possible conflict zone soon.

Glassnode’s data indicates that while the region near previous all-time highs hasn’t seen dense buying activity, the concentration at $106,600 stands out. It appears that many investors who acquired Bitcoin at that price level have held on through the volatility and market fluctuations that followed.

Their steadfast position could mean that should Bitcoin’s price approach this threshold again, these holders might be tempted to sell and recover their initial investments, thereby exerting downward pressure, or possibly reinforcing a support level.

Potential Impacts on Short-Term Price Action

The emergence of this cost basis cluster suggests that the $106,600 level could play a double role. On one hand, it may act as resistance if a surge in bullish momentum pushes the price upward.

On the other, should the market dip, the accumulated strength at this level might serve as a form of support, as underwater holders hover near their break-even points and are reluctant to sell at a loss.

Traders are now analyzing the dynamics behind this unique distribution to gauge future price movements. A rapid ascent towards the $106,600 mark could trigger a flurry of activity, with profit-taking and technical responses influencing market sentiment.

Conversely, if Bitcoin fails to breach this barrier, the level could reinforce caution among investors, setting the stage for consolidation. As Bitcoin continues its resilient run in a volatile market, this specific price cluster offers valuable insights into investor behavior and market structure.
